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to disclose sensitive information on vulnerable installations of Foxit Reader.

The vulnerability exists within the handling of SWF files inside PDF files. A remote unauthenticated attacker can obtain sensitive information by tricking a victim to visit a malicious page or open a malicious file.

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.

Affected software

Foxit PDF Reader for Windows
Foxit PDF Editor (formerly Foxit PhantomPDF)

Remediation

Update your applications to the latest versions, which can be found at: https://www.foxitsoftware.com/support/security-bulletins.php
